Piyush Shakya has authored 18 papers that have received a total of 334 indexed citations.
This includes 15 papers in Mechanical Engineering, 15 papers in Control and Systems Engineering and 5 papers in Mechanics of Materials. The topics of these papers are Machine Fault Diagnosis Techniques (14 papers), Gear and Bearing Dynamics Analysis (12 papers) and Fault Detection and Control Systems (6 papers). Piyush Shakya is often cited by papers focused on Machine Fault Diagnosis Techniques (14 papers), Gear and Bearing Dynamics Analysis (12 papers) and Fault Detection and Control Systems (6 papers) and collaborates with scholars based in India. Piyush Shakya's co-authors include Ashish K. Darpe, Makarand S. Kulkarni, N. Ramesh Babu, S. Narayanan and A. S. Sekhar and has published in prestigious journals such as Journal of Sound and Vibration, Measurement and Mechanism and Machine Theory.
